Why Airspace Closures Change Airfares So Quickly
Longer routes are more expensive to operate
The simplest pricing effect is fuel. If a carrier has to route around a closed corridor, the aircraft spends more time in the air, which means more fuel burn, more crew time, and sometimes an additional technical stop. Airlines price that risk into future schedules, even when the immediate disruption appears temporary. In practical terms, the aircraft that was supposed to operate a profitable city pair may no longer fit the same schedule economics, and that can lift the lowest fare buckets or eliminate them entirely.
This is one reason travelers often see fare spikes on routes that do not seem geographically close to the conflict. International networks are tightly connected, and the loss of a single overflight path can ripple across continents. Premium cabins can be affected too: when airlines have fewer efficient widebody rotations, they may protect business-class and premium-economy inventory for higher-yield corporate travelers, leaving leisure travelers with fewer discounted options. Capacity shifts are often more important than headlines
Travelers tend to focus on the airspace closure itself, but the bigger fare story is usually capacity management. If airlines cut frequencies, swap to smaller aircraft, or suspend marginal routes, there are fewer seats to sell at every price point. That compression is especially noticeable on nonstop long-haul flying, where a single lost departure can wipe out dozens of low-fare seats and several premium-cabin upgrade opportunities. The market then behaves like a smaller marketplace with higher marginal prices, even if demand remains steady.
When carriers redeploy aircraft away from disrupted regions, they also reshuffle availability elsewhere. A route from New York to Dubai might become less reliable, while New York to Doha or Istanbul could gain traffic as passengers follow the new routing logic. Airline pricing reacts to uncertainty, not just cost
Airlines do not wait for every added dollar of operating cost to show up before repricing. They react to uncertainty. If they believe a closure could last, expand, or recur, they may raise fares preemptively on exposed routes because they expect future seat scarcity. That means travelers often see fare changes before any schedule is officially reduced. In other words, the market prices risk before it prices the final routing outcome.
That uncertainty also affects indirect itineraries. A route that previously relied on a smooth two-hour connection may suddenly need three hours or more because of late arrivals, fewer frequencies, or different aircraft assignments. Once the airline’s network planners decide a connection bank is no longer reliable, the fare structure can shift again to reflect the new operational reality. How Flight Rerouting Changes Schedules, Block Times, and Reliability
Detours add minutes, then hours, then missed turns
On paper, a rerouted flight may only gain 20 to 40 minutes. In practice, that additional time compounds across the network. Crew duty limits, gate occupancy, arrival slot timing, and aircraft utilization all become harder to manage when the flight no longer follows its planned track. One delayed inbound aircraft can delay the entire day’s rotation, especially on long-haul fleets where the same plane is supposed to operate multiple segments.
For passengers, this often appears as a schedule shift that seems small enough to ignore until the day of travel. But the flight may now arrive outside the airline’s preferred connection bank, which means your once-safe 75-minute layover is suddenly a gamble. Travelers who book complex connections should compare the airline’s published minimum connection times with real-world transfer patterns and be conservative when the routing crosses disrupted regions.
Schedule padding masks the real strain
One common airline response is to add padding to published flight times. This reduces the appearance of poor on-time performance, but it also makes some routes less attractive. When a long-haul itinerary gets an extra 45 minutes of scheduled time, the connection may no longer line up with a partner airline’s bank of departures. Over time, the published timetable itself becomes evidence of the network adaptation, not just the temporary disruption.
This is where travelers should watch for subtle changes: a route may still be marketed as nonstop, but its departure time shifts by an hour or more, or a connection is re-timed to a less convenient bank. Hub dependence is the hidden schedule risk
The most vulnerable itineraries are those that depend on a single mega-hub. If a hub airport becomes constrained by overflight restrictions, the airline may move flights to other hubs, but passengers with through tickets often face the worst of both worlds: longer total journey time and reduced connection flexibility. This is especially true for long-haul carriers that funnel traffic through Gulf or Eastern Mediterranean hubs before distributing it across Asia, Africa, and Europe. If that hub loses efficiency, every downstream leg inherits the problem.
That is why regional diversification matters. Airlines that can shift flights across multiple hubs may retain more resilience, while carriers with concentrated hubs can become more exposed to airspace shocks. For travelers, the practical takeaway is to favor itineraries with stronger contingency options, such as multiple daily departures, self-protective connection windows, or backup routings through alternate hubs.
Layover Risk: Where Missed Connections Become More Likely
Short connections are the first casualty
When airspace closures slow flights down, layover risk rises fastest on short connections. A 50-minute hub transfer that once worked because the inbound flight arrived consistently on time can fail once the schedule is padded or the flight is rerouted. Even a modest delay can trigger a missed connection if the aircraft arrives at a remote stand, if immigration queues spike, or if gates change late. Travelers often blame the airport, but the root cause is usually the airline’s weakened timetable assumptions.
If you are flying internationally, it is wise to extend your connection buffer when crossing a network affected by conflict-related airspace restrictions. Use published minimum connection times as a floor, not a target. On vulnerable routes, two hours may not be enough if you must clear security again, move terminals, or rebook onto the next bank. Travelers booking self-transfers should be even more cautious, because the airline will not automatically protect them if the first segment is delayed.
Banked hubs can become bottlenecks
Airlines love banked hubs because they allow efficient connections, but banked hubs also create bottlenecks when operations are stressed. If a wave of arrivals gets delayed by longer routing, the next wave of departures may be held, causing cascading congestion. That can lead to gate holds, missed crew sign-ins, baggage transfer failures, and missed long-haul departures that are difficult to rebook quickly. The busiest hub operations can absorb some shocks, but not all of them at once.
This is where travelers should pay attention to the airline’s rebooking posture. Some carriers are generous with same-day changes and protected connections; others are stricter and may reroute you through a different city or force an overnight stay. Missed connections are not random; they cluster
Missed connections tend to cluster around certain times of day, certain hubs, and certain route types. Late-evening long-hauls, where there is little recovery margin, are especially vulnerable. So are itineraries that connect from a delayed regional feeder onto a single daily intercontinental departure. If the connection fails, you may lose an entire day, and premium-cabin travelers may be rebooked into a cabin that does not match the original fare class unless inventory is available.
That is why travelers should think in terms of network fragility rather than just connection length. A 90-minute connection on a stable corridor can be safer than a 150-minute connection on a highly disrupted one. The best strategy is to look at the total itinerary, not just the layover duration. What Happens to Premium Cabins When Routes Get Longer
Premium demand can stay strong even as networks weaken
One of the most important trends in airline economics is that premium demand can remain resilient even when economy travelers become more price-sensitive. The Delta results highlighted strong interest in expensive seats, and that pattern matters in a disruption environment because airlines often preserve premium inventory on the routes they most want to protect. If a carrier believes a long-haul route will remain valuable, it may keep business-class seats high priced and reduce discount availability rather than flood the market with lower fares. That is why some travelers see very expensive premium cabins even as the schedule gets worse.
For passengers, this creates a confusing split: economy fares may swing sharply depending on inventory and routing, while premium cabins remain firm because the airline sees them as strategically important. If you are booking a premium-cabin trip during a period of airspace instability, compare not only the fare, but also the aircraft type, seat map, and likely rerouting options. A premium fare on a more resilient routing may be better value than a cheaper fare on a fragile one.
Aircraft swaps can change the whole product
When airlines adjust schedules, they may also swap aircraft types. A route initially planned on a newer widebody with better premium-economy or business-class seats can be downgraded to an older frame if the aircraft rotation changes. That means the traveler who bought a “premium” experience can end up with a different seat layout, less privacy, or inferior service flow. The issue is not just comfort; it can affect baggage capacity, cabin service timing, and upgrade availability.

Premium travelers still need to watch the fine print
Premium cabins are not immunity against disruption. In fact, they can be more expensive to protect because airlines may prioritize elite rebooking, upgrade clearing, and seat assignments for high-yield customers. If your route is likely to be rerouted, check whether your fare includes flexible changes, same-day switch options, or refundable terms. A lower upfront fare can be a bad deal if the itinerary is fragile and the airline’s recovery options are limited.
For travelers who value flexibility, comparing bundled fare options matters more than ever. Which Routing Patterns Travelers Should Watch Next
Alternate hubs are the first obvious change
When one corridor becomes unreliable, airlines often shift traffic to alternate hubs. Travelers should watch for routings that move from one Gulf, Eastern Mediterranean, or Central European hub to another. This can mean a longer total travel time, but it can also create better resilience if the alternate hub is less exposed to closure risk. The key question is not simply which hub is best on paper, but which hub currently offers the most stable schedule and enough frequency to recover from delays.
For travelers monitoring regional shifts, it helps to think like a network planner. Look for routes that connect through hubs with multiple daily banks, alternative long-haul departure times, and strong partner coverage. When airlines can spread risk across more than one hub, passengers gain more options. When they cannot, the itinerary becomes much more brittle.
One-stop itineraries may replace nonstops
Another pattern to watch is the return of one-stop itineraries on routes that used to be marketed as nonstop or near-nonstop. That can happen because the carrier no longer has a safe or efficient overflight path, or because aircraft utilization no longer supports the original schedule. The fare may initially look lower than the nonstop, but the hidden cost is time, missed-connection risk, and a higher chance of involuntary rerouting. Travelers planning winter or high-demand trips should compare the full journey, not just the headline fare.
It is also possible for airlines to create “pseudo-nonstop” markets, where a flight technically remains nonstop but the departure and arrival times are altered enough to make it less useful for onward connections. That is why schedule change monitoring is essential. Premium-heavy city pairs may hold up better
Routes with strong business travel or premium leisure demand often stay alive longer than purely price-driven leisure routes. In a disruption environment, airlines may retain these city pairs because premium demand helps offset the extra operating cost of rerouting. As a result, premium-cabin seats can remain available on certain trunk routes even while smaller markets lose service. Travelers should not assume a route is safe just because it looks busy; instead, consider whether the airline has enough yield to justify protecting it.
That’s also where route comparison becomes a value tool, not just a travel-planning tool. If a premium-heavy route is stable but expensive, an alternate city pair might offer better value even if it adds one connection. To assess overall value, compare not only fares but also baggage rules, seat assignments, and change flexibility. How Travelers Can Protect Themselves Before Booking
Choose resilience over the absolute lowest fare
In a volatile network, the cheapest fare is often the most expensive mistake. A slightly higher fare on a better-timed route with a stronger hub and more daily frequency can save you a missed meeting, an overnight hotel, or a rebooking headache. Travelers should weigh flexibility, connection quality, and airline recovery reputation alongside price. If the trip is time-sensitive, the ability to rebook quickly may be worth more than the lowest published fare.
It also helps to think about the airline’s broader operating model. Some carriers build networks around deep hubs and high utilization, while others are more point-to-point and less exposed to overflight sensitivity. During airspace disruption, the more diversified network often wins. Book connections with margin, not hope
If your itinerary crosses any region facing airspace restrictions, avoid tight connections unless you have a compelling reason and a very high tolerance for disruption. Aim for routes with protected through-ticketing, reliable partner airline arrangements, and enough frequency that a missed connection does not end the trip. For self-transfers, add even more margin because the airline’s obligations are much weaker if one segment is delayed.

Pay attention to fare rules and change windows
When airspace instability is high, fare rules matter more than ever. Some tickets allow free changes only if the airline issues a formal schedule change or waiver; others are more flexible but have higher upfront cost. If your route is likely to be affected, it can make sense to buy the fare with the least painful change policy rather than the lowest base price. That is especially true for premium cabins, where a rebooking can be hard to replicate at the same price.
Travelers who want to keep a lid on uncertainty should also watch for ancillary traps, such as checked-bag fees, seat fees, and same-day change penalties. Real-World Takeaways for the Next Few Months
Expect more rerouting, not just more cancellations
As conflicts persist, airlines generally prefer rerouting over outright cancellation because they want to preserve revenue and customer confidence. That means travelers are more likely to face longer journeys, changed connection points, and new layover risks than a total loss of service. It also means the market may look “normal” until you inspect the flight path, the aircraft type, and the connection logic. The operational change is often invisible to casual shoppers but very visible to anyone with a tight connection or premium-cabin expectations.
Pro Tip: If a route suddenly looks cheaper than usual during a geopolitical shock, check whether the itinerary gained an extra stop, switched hubs, or changed to a less convenient schedule. The lowest fare is not always the best value when the airline has quietly absorbed more operational risk into the fare.
Watch for capacity migration into safer hubs
One likely outcome is that airlines will shift more capacity into hubs and corridors that are less exposed to overflight restrictions. That can temporarily improve availability on some routes while making others scarce. Travelers should watch for route growth into alternate hubs, especially where carriers have strong partner networks and enough aircraft flexibility to preserve connections. These changes can last long after the headline crisis fades because airlines are reluctant to reverse expensive schedule adjustments too quickly.

Comparison Table: What Changes When Airspace Closes
| Impact Area | What Travelers See | Why It Happens | Who Feels It Most | How to Respond |
|---|---|---|---|---|
| Fares | Higher prices or fewer low-fare seats | Extra fuel, less capacity, risk pricing | Leisure travelers, late bookers | Book early, compare alternate hubs |
| Schedules | Departures shift, flight times lengthen | Rerouting and aircraft rotation changes | Anyone with tight timing | Favor more frequent routes |
| Layovers | Missed connections, longer connections needed | Late arrivals and reduced connection reliability | One-stop itineraries | Add buffer, avoid self-transfers |
| Premium cabins | High fares, limited discounts, aircraft swaps | Airlines protect yield and premium demand | Business travelers, premium leisure | Check aircraft type and change rules |
| Airline capacity | Cut frequencies, smaller aircraft, hub shifts | Operational efficiency and safety constraints | All travelers on exposed routes | Watch network changes and alternate routings |
FAQ: Airspace Closures, Flights, and Layovers
How does an airspace closure make flights more expensive?
Airlines may have to fly longer routes, burn more fuel, pay more in crew and operational costs, and reduce seat supply. They also price in uncertainty, so fares can rise before the full operational impact is visible.
Will my nonstop flight always stay nonstop during a conflict?
No. Some nonstops remain intact, but airlines may retime flights, reroute them, or use different aircraft to preserve service. A route can also stay “nonstop” on paper while becoming less convenient because of schedule padding.
Are layover risks higher on long-haul itineraries?
Yes, especially when long-haul flights arrive late into a hub bank or when the connection depends on a single daily onward departure. The longer the itinerary and the fewer the frequency options, the greater the risk of a missed connection.
Do premium cabins protect me from disruption?
Not fully. Premium passengers may get better rebooking priority or more flexible fares, but they are still affected by reroutes, aircraft swaps, and schedule changes. In some cases, premium cabins are even more expensive during disruption because airlines protect those seats.
What routing patterns should I watch for next?
Look for shifts to alternate hubs, the return of one-stop itineraries, longer scheduled block times, and aircraft swaps on long-haul routes. These are usually the first signs that the airline is adapting to a new airspace reality.
Is it better to book the cheapest fare or the most flexible fare?
If your trip is time-sensitive or involves a fragile connection, flexibility often wins. The cheapest fare can become expensive after baggage fees, rebooking pain, or an overnight delay. Compare the full trip cost, not just the base fare.
